preguntar acerca de interface

12
réponses

Tester si l’objet implémente l’interface

Quel est le moyen le plus simple de tester si un objet implémente une interface donnée en C#? (Réponse à cette question en Java) ... …
demandé sur 1970-01-01 00:33:29
24
réponses

Comment puis-je savoir quand créer une interface?

Je suis à un moment de mon apprentissage du développement où j'ai l'impression de devoir en apprendre davantage sur les interfaces. Je lis souvent à leur sujet, mais il semble juste que je ne peux pas les saisir. J'ai lu des exemples comme: Animal …
demandé sur 1970-01-01 00:33:29
7
réponses

Que signifie «programme aux interfaces, pas aux implémentations»?

On tombe sur cette phrase en lisant sur les modèles de conception. Mais je ne comprends pas, quelqu'un pourrait-il m'expliquer cela? ... …
demandé sur 1970-01-01 00:33:30
6
réponses

Pourquoi une interface ne peut pas implémenter une autre interface?

Ce que je veux dire est: interface B {...} interface A extends B {...} // allowed interface A implements B {...} // not allowed Je l'ai googlé et j'ai trouvé ce: implements indique la définition d'une mise en œuvre pour les méthodes d'une …
demandé sur 1970-01-01 00:33:30
26
réponses

Pourquoi ne puis-je pas saisir les interfaces?

Quelqu'un pourrait-il démystifier les interfaces pour moi ou me montrer de bons exemples? Je continue à voir des interfaces apparaître ici et là, mais je n'ai jamais vraiment été exposé à de bonnes explications sur les interfaces ou quand les utilise …
demandé sur 1970-01-01 00:33:28
10
réponses

Xcode: Possible de créer automatiquement des stubs pour les méthodes requises par L’interface de protocole?

Venant D'un arrière-plan Eclipse / Java, l'une de mes fonctionnalités préférées est la possibilité de supprimer rapidement toutes les méthodes requises par une interface. Dans Eclipse, je peux choisir 'Override / implement' dans le menu source pour …
demandé sur 1970-01-01 00:33:29
8
réponses

interface en tant que paramètre de méthode en Java

J'ai eu une interview il y a quelques jours et on m'a posé une question comme celle-ci. Q: Inverser une liste liée. Code suivant est donné: public class ReverseList { interface NodeList { int getItem(); NodeList nextNode(); …
demandé sur 1970-01-01 00:33:30
7
réponses

Passage de la classe D’Interface en tant que paramètre en Java

J'ai une interface: public interface IMech { } , Et une classe qui l'implémente public class Email implements IMech { } Et une troisième classe qui a cette méthode implémentée: public void sendNotification( Class< IMech > mechanism ){ …
demandé sur 1970-01-01 00:33:30
11
réponses

Interface en tant que type en Java?

À Partir De Les Tutoriels Java : En Java, une classe peut hériter d'une seule classe mais elle peut implémenter plus d'une interface. Par conséquent, les objets peuvent avoir plusieurs types : le type de leur propre classe et les types de t …
demandé sur 1970-01-01 00:33:31
4
réponses

Comment référencer un type de retour générique avec plusieurs limites

J'ai récemment vu que l'on peut déclarer un type de retour qui est également limité par une interface. Considérez la classe et l'interface suivantes: public class Foo { public String getFoo() { ... } } public interface Bar { public void se …
demandé sur 1970-01-01 00:33:33